Study Summary

The purpose of this study is to learn if BMS-646256 can cause weight loss in men and women who are: * overweight with high blood pressure or high cholesterol or * obese The safety of this treatment will also be studied

Interventions

  • DRUG Placebo
  • DRUG BMS-646256

Trial Details

FieldValue
Enrollment Target 705 participants
Start Date 2006-11
Est. Completion 2009-04
